怎样在access中使用SQL语句为一张表添加多行

怎样在access中使用SQL语句为一张表添加多行... 怎样在access中使用SQL语句为一张表添加多行 展开
 我来答
不想起名字了99
2014-08-08 · TA获得超过1695个赞
知道大有可为答主
回答量:2708
采纳率:76%
帮助的人:730万
展开全部
如果民数据来源于其他表,则一条语句可完成
如果是其他来源,就只能使用代码完成
就是用多行
docmd.runsql "insert ........"

具体的,你可以把语句放到一个数组中,进行循环
也可以把语句放到另外一个表中
然后用DAO对象查询出来,再循环执行

还可以放到一个文本文件中
用函数取出来循环执行

等等
追问
用“insert into diantable (dian) select dian from databook group by dian”解决了
想问一下已知表格中的一个数据,怎样将与该数据同一行的另一个数据选择出来并赋给一个变量呢?
追答
这个得用DAO或ADO来完成
j假如你的变量叫
MYVAR

dim rs as recordset
set rs=currentdb.openrecordset("select 字段1,字段2 from 表1 where 条件")'SQL你得自己写,这只是个示例
rs.movefirst
MYVAR=rs.fields("字段1")
本回答被提问者和网友采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
绿衣人敲门
2014-08-08 · 知道合伙人软件行家
绿衣人敲门
知道合伙人软件行家
采纳数:18765 获赞数:63778
毕业于西北大学计算机网络技术专业,现在在西安电力学院进行网络推广维护工作!

向TA提问 私信TA
展开全部
例:alter table Dep add column DepID Int
在Access里,像表Dep中增加DepID的列,类型为数字
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式